Illume Learning is thrilled to present this highly requested workshop especially for teaching assistants!
Teaching assistants are essential to the success of inclusive classrooms - but the role is often shaped by expectations that don’t reflect what we now know about best practice. This workshop is designed specifically for teaching assistants who want to build their knowledge, feel confident in their role, and provide support that makes a genuine, positive impact.
You’ll explore what the research says about inclusion and the role of TAs, and gain practical strategies you can start using straight away. The day draws on international evidence and real examples from schools across Australia and New Zealand - and is grounded in respect for the rights and strengths of every student.
Whether you’re new to the job or have years of experience, this is a chance to deepen your understanding, ask questions, and connect with others who care deeply about inclusion.
Discover how to:
- Support students respectfully and effectively
- Promote independence and inclusion
- Understand behaviour through a strengths-based lens
- Make a lasting difference in your school
Workshop program
9:00am – Registration
9:30am – Understanding Disability in 2025: Explore the social model of disability, inclusive language, and strength-based thinking
10:00am – What Does It Mean to Include Students with Disability?: Unpack the research and reflect on what real inclusion looks like (and what it doesn’t)
10:45am – Morning tea
11:00am – Re-Thinking the Role of Teaching Assistants: What the research tells us about Teaching Assistant impact and how to support students in ways that truly work
12:00pm – Behaviour: Explore student behaviour through the lens of “kids do well if they can” and learn how to respond with empathy and understanding
12:45pm – Lunch
1:30pm – Practical Support Strategies: Learn how to support students with executive function, memory, communication, motor skills, and sensory needs
2:30pm – Finish
